Strategic Planning Director jobs in Santa Maria, CA

Strategic Planning Director directs and oversees an organization's strategic and long-range goal planning function. Drives strategic initiatives and supports the development of long-term growth plans and profitability goals. Being a Strategic Planning Director analyzes emerging industry trends, expansion opportunities, including mergers and acquisitions, competitive threats, the viability of outside business partners, and sources of capital. Establishes and retains relationships with industry analysts and the investment community. Additionally, Strategic Planning Director utilizes data-driven methodologies to analyze business performance metrics and process improvement options effectively. Develops reporting and tools to communicate strategic plans and concepts to leadership. Conducts periodic status reviews of organizational goals and objectives to identify roadblocks to progress. Requires a bachelor's degree. Typically reports to top management. The Strategic Planning Director manages a departmental sub-function within a broader departmental function. Creates functional strategies and specific objectives for the sub-function and develops budgets/policies/procedures to support the functional infrastructure. To be a Strategic Planning Director typically requires 5+ years of managerial experience. Deep knowledge of the managed sub-function and solid knowledge of the overall departmental function. Director of Planning - Facilities Planning and Capital Projects
  • The California State University
  • San Luis Obispo, CA FULL_TIME
  • Are you ready to join the team?  Well keep reading then!

    Job Summary

    Under the general direction of the Executive Director of Facilities Planning and Capital Projects (FPCP), the Director of Planning is responsible for campus environmental planning and the management of a comprehensive planning program. The position manages the professional and technical staff of the FPCP Campus Planning and Space Optimization units to meet institutional goals and strategic objectives, ensures campus compliance on capital projects, and oversees coordination and collaboration with all other departments within FMD and throughout the campus. The Director of Planning creates plans, tools, and guidelines to effectively and efficiently allocate and secure the space and campus resources required by university programs and activities.  The position directs the planning efforts of all projects and allocates staff time and resources to meet campus master planning, capital projects environmental planning, and space management goals while maintaining effective standards of service, guidance, and interactions provided to the campus in accordance with best business and professional practices. This position is a campus strategic partner who values diversity, equity, and inclusion, focuses on collaboration, creates an innovative and positive environment, and leads with integrity and authenticity.

    Department Summary

    Facilities Management and Development (FMD), a unit within the Administration and Finance Division (AFD), is responsible for the planning, design, construction, operations, maintenance, and repair of university facilities and grounds. FMD consists of five critical and interdependent support departments, including Facilities Customer & Business Services; Energy, Utilities, & Sustainability; Environmental Health & Safety; Facilities Planning & Capital Projects; and Facility Operations. In support of the Cal Poly mission, FMD is committed to promoting a culture that values individual and organizational integrity, civility, and diversity.

    Key Qualifications

    • Extensive knowledge of and ability to apply expertise in facilities management practices and space management policies, standards and procedures of a large, complex-related business or organization.
    • Thorough working knowledge of public and private entities including their organizational and operating structures, internal systems, and functional areas, as well as the impact of critical external entities on an organization.
    • Thorough knowledge of project management methods and best practices.
    • Knowledge of or ability to interpret and integrate complex data and information to formulate appropriate courses of action that would have broad and far-reaching impact.
    • Ability to understand and analyze complex problems from a future-oriented and broad interactive perspective and readily develop proactive solutions that integrate strategic goals into tactical operations.

    Education and Experience

    • Bachelor’s Degree in Architecture or related field and eight (8) years of progressively responsible experience in professional facilities management, planning, administration, or management of large, complex-related business or organization, including three (3) years of people management experience. Additional qualifying experience may be substituted for the required degree on a year-for-year basis.

Santa Maria is a city near the Southern California coast in Santa Barbara County. It is approximately 65 miles (105 km) northwest of Santa Barbara and 150 miles (240 km) northwest of downtown Los Angeles. Its estimated 2018 population was 108,470, making it the most populous city in the county and the Santa Maria-Santa Barbara, CA Metro Area. The city is notable for its wine industry and Santa Maria-style barbecue. Sunset magazine called Santa Maria "The West's Best BBQ Town".
